
Blue Note
With a focus on genuinely dark tones, Blue Note (2129-30) is a standout Gray in our database. It was selected for this featured gallery for its ability to anchor a room without demanding the spotlight. See it applied across 21 real world scenarios and find professional pairing data below.
Hex
#404B54
LRV
9.02
Blue Note in Real Rooms
Blue Note has a low LRV of 9.02 — it absorbs light and reads as a genuinely dark, enveloping color. It's neutral in temperature, making it adaptable across different lighting conditions and room orientations.
